Overview
  • In this course, you learn how to make infrastructure choices to support containerized applications running on Amazon Elastic Container Service (Amazon ECS) at an enterprise scale. You learn how to scope requirements based on your application, select the best architecture to support your application, and design reusable infrastructure patterns that are secure, performant, and resilient.

    Course objectives

    In this course, you learn to:

    • Design and build an architecture to support the needs of your application.
    • Select the right design and tooling for building reusable infrastructure patterns.
